Chris Froome will tomorrow become the first ever British cyclist to win the Giro d’Italia after finishing the penultimate stage just ahead of Tom Dumoulin. Froome shattered the field yesterday, breaking on his own from 50 km out and finishing 3 minutes ahead of Dumoulin, which put him in the maglio rosa with a 40 second lead. Dumoulin, the defending champion, was until yesterday in the lead, with Froome back in 4th place. Froome will simultaneously hold the titles of all 3 Grand Tours, having won last year’s Tour de France and Vuelta á España.
